Gridiron Insurance Underwriters, Inc., a program manager that specializes in program business on a regional and national basis through select retail and wholesale producers, will release a new inland marine product called Inland Pro E-Portal on August 20, 2013.
The Inland Pro web portal will specifically focus on small inland marine business. The portal will have the ability to quote, bind and issue seven different inland marine classifications with low minimum premium thresholds.
Eligible classifications on the portal include: contractors equipment, bailee’s, builder’s risk, EDP, mobile medical equipment, motor truck cargo and miscellaneous property floaters.
Coverage is offered by AGCS Marine Insurance Co., a company of Allianz Global & Corporate Specialty. Inland Pro can be accessed via www.gridironins.com by appointed wholesalers and select retailers. Coverage is available in 20 states on an admitted basis.
